As an Operating Room Nurse in our state-of-the-art Orthopedic Surgery Center , you’ll play a critical role in ensuring safe, efficient, and compassionate care for our patients. From preparing the OR and assisting surgeons to supporting patients before, during, and after surgery, you’ll be at the heart of life-changing procedures.

What You’ll Do:
✔️ Work alongside an elite team of surgeons, anesthesiologists, and healthcare professionals to ensure optimal patient outcomes
✔️ Assist in preparing the operating room , ensuring all supplies and equipment are ready
✔️ Provide hands-on support during procedures, including scrubbing in and passing instruments
✔️ Monitor patients’ vital signs and overall well-being throughout the surgical process
✔️ Maintain accurate and thorough patient documentation
✔️ Adhere to the highest safety and infection control standards
✔️ Be a trusted advocate for your patients, providing comfort and clear communication throughout their surgical experience

What You Bring to the Team:
Registered Nurse (RN) license (Maine or eligible for licensure)
Experience in a surgical setting (scrubbing experience required; orthopedic experience a plus!)
Certifications: BLS (required), ACLS (required), CNOR (preferred)
